BALTIMORE – An East Baltimore man told WJZ that the driver of a semi-truck hit his car and then pushed it through traffic, and then drove away.

Walter Brown says he is still shaken up from this incident.

Part of the hit and run was captured by security cameras.

“The only thing I can look at is the grill of this truck, hoping that he doesn’t either run over top of me or ram me into some wall or somebody’s house,” Brown said.

The hit-and-run crash happened around 6:20 a.m. on Thursday.

Brown says he was driving to to work when he was hit by a semi-truck on Biddle Street.

“The front right of his truck hit the back of my car, causing my car to spin,” Brown said. “As I’m facing left and right he’s pushing me down the street.”

Brown says he was blaring on the horn but the truck continued pushing his car through traffic for about a minute before running him into a parked pick up truck. The truck sped off.
